Abstract
In this paper, we first show the global existence, uniqueness and regularity of weak solutions for the hyperbolic magnetohydrodynamics (MHD) equations in ℝ3ℝ3. Then we establish that the solutions with initial data belonging to Hm(ℝ3)∩L1(ℝ3)Hm(ℝ3)∩L1(ℝ3) have the following time decay rate: ‖m∇u(x,t)‖2+‖m∇b(x,t)‖2+‖∇m+1u(x,t)‖2+‖∇m+1b(x,t)‖2≤c(1+t)-3/2-m‖∇mu(x,t)‖2+‖∇mb(x,t)‖2+‖∇m+1u(x,t)‖2+‖∇m+1b(x,t)‖2≤c(1+t)-3/2-m for large t, where m = 0, 1.
